peaceman99 Posted December 20, 2011 Posted December 20, 2011 (edited) Hello everybody =) I've been playing the game without any problems for about 3 weeks now, and yesterday when I started the game, everything was running just a bit faster than normal. Restarting the game and the PC didn't help. all animations, effects, etc... run a bit faster than they should normally do (about 1.5 times faster). It's not unplayable but incredibly annoying and it kills the whole atmosphere that makes the game great! I'm sure i didn't change anything significant on my PC, since i played the game just an hour before, and everything was normal...I've already tried reinstalling the game but i didn't help. I'm playing the game on an Acer Notebook, Processor is Intel Core 2 Duo T58004 GB RamNVIDIA GeForce 9600M GTEdit OS is Windows Vista 32bit Do you have any suggestions how to fix this, or has anyone encountered the same problem? Sorry about the joke trolling ;3 But to disable V-sync, go into your .ini file and add iPresentInterval=0 at the bottem of the [Display] section. Edited December 20, 2011 by Lius

maboru Posted December 20, 2011 Posted December 20, 2011 If you play with Steam online then you got the new LAA patch today so that probably reset your inis. Start the game from the Skyrim launcher or TESV.exe and see if that helps. If not try one of the frame limiter mods and see if that helps.
